Canadian swimming sensation Summer McIntosh is set to make a splash at the upcoming World Championships, competing in an ambitious five events. Among these is her much-anticipated showdown against American superstar Katie Ledecky, a race McIntosh has described as her “biggest challenge” yet. With eyes fixed on the global stage, the young athlete aims to solidify her status among the sport’s elite while pushing her limits across multiple disciplines.

Strategies for Managing Multiple Events and Maximizing Performance in Elite Competition

Elite swimmers like Summer McIntosh face a rigorous balancing act when competing in multiple events at a single championship. To maintain top form across various disciplines, athletes employ strategic scheduling and recovery techniques. Prioritizing heats and finals based on event difficulty and competitor strength allows for optimal energy distribution throughout the meet. Nutrition also plays a pivotal role; tailored meal plans ensure peak energy levels and efficient muscle recovery between sessions. Moreover, mental conditioning-including visualization and focused breathing exercises-helps maintain concentration amid the intense pressure of back-to-back races.

Key Strategies Include:

  • Energy Management: Allocating effort strategically across events to avoid burnout.
  • Recovery Protocols: Utilizing ice baths, massages, and stretching between heats and finals.
  • Customized Nutrition: Intake of carbohydrates and electrolytes timed around event schedules.
  • Mental Preparation: Techniques to sustain focus, especially when facing formidable opponents like Katie Ledecky.
